Finding the best cheap insurance deals can be a daunting task, especially if you're unsure where to start. To make this process easier, begin by comparing quotes from multiple providers. Websites that aggregate insurance quotes allow you to see various options side by side, which can help you identify the most affordable policies. Additionally, pay close attention to the coverage details, as the cheapest policy might not always meet your needs. Once you've gathered a list of potential options, consider using price comparison tools to narrow down your search further.
Another effective strategy is to leverage discounts offered by insurance companies. Many providers offer savings for various reasons, such as bundling multiple policies, being a safe driver, or maintaining a good credit score. It’s also wise to check if there are any group discounts available through professional organizations or alumni associations that you belong to. Lastly, don't hesitate to negotiate with insurance agents; sometimes, they are willing to adjust rates or offer special promotions to secure your business.
Understanding policy terms is crucial for anyone looking to manage insurance costs effectively. Policy terms define the specific provisions, limitations, and conditions under which an insurance company will cover claims. These terms can greatly affect the overall price of your premiums. For example, policies with lower deductibles often come with higher annual costs, while those with higher deductibles may offer more affordable premiums but require you to pay more out-of-pocket in the event of a claim. Additionally, factors like the coverage limits and exclusions outlined in your policy can significantly impact your financial responsibility regarding potential claims.
Moreover, it’s important to understand that insurance policies can vary widely between providers, making it essential to compare the terms side-by-side. Always pay attention to key components such as coverage type, premium payment structures, and any available discounts for bundling multiple policies. By comprehensively analyzing these factors, you can make informed decisions that not only help minimize your insurance costs but also ensure you have adequate coverage for your needs. Taking the time to fully grasp these policy terms empowers you to find a balance between affordability and sufficient protection.
